Add additional functionality to the Sorcery API.
This commit adds native implementation support for copying and diffing objects, as well as the ability to load or reload on a per-object type level. Review: https://reviewboard.asterisk.org/r/2320/ git-svn-id: https://origsvn.digium.com/svn/asterisk/trunk@381134 65c4cc65-6c06-0410-ace0-fbb531ad65f3
